refactoring some methodes

This commit is contained in:
ragu 2023-03-05 20:01:47 +01:00
parent 697a29b97d
commit 729dad2be4
28 changed files with 567 additions and 2323 deletions

View file

@ -7,7 +7,7 @@ use Mod::Buttons;
use Mod::Libenzdb;
use Mod::DBtank;
use Data::Dumper;
my $q = new CGI;
my $db = new Libenzdb;
my $dbt = new DBtank;
my $but = new Buttons;
@ -22,12 +22,14 @@ sub new {
#Template
sub tpl(){
my $self = shift;
my $q = shift;
my $node_meta = shift;
my $users_dms = shift;
my $mode = shift || "";
my $varenv = shift;
my $users_sharee = shift || "";
my $feedb = shift || "";
$q->import_names('R');
my $user_agent = $q->user_agent();
@ -190,7 +192,7 @@ sub tpl(){
require "Tpl/Karte_osm.pm";
&Karte_osm::tpl($node_meta,$users_dms,$mode,$varenv,$users_sharee,$feedb);
}else{
$self->tplselect($node_meta,$users_dms,$mode,$varenv,$users_sharee,$feedb);
$self->tplselect($q,$node_meta,$users_dms,$mode,$varenv,$users_sharee,$feedb);
}
if($project ne "Freiburg"){
@ -270,12 +272,14 @@ EOF
#2021-05-05 changed to Mlogic
sub tplselect(){
my $self = shift;
my $q = shift;
my $node_meta = shift;
my $users_dms = shift || "";
my $mode = shift || "";
my $varenv = shift;
my $users_sharee = shift || "";
my $feedb = shift || "";
$q->import_names('R');
my $lang = "de";
my $tpl_id = $node_meta->{tpl_id};